Quick fit notes
- Size: cat should stand, turn, lie comfortably; pick compressible models for tight under-seat sizers.
- Airline: check your carrier’s under-seat dimensions and soft-sided language for your specific route/plane.
- Car setup: use the seatbelt pass-through; place on a non-slip mat to cut rumble.

Pre-trip checklist
- ID tag + microchip up to date
- Small leash/harness + waste bags
- Familiar blanket (smell = calmer cat)
- Collapsible water cup (airport/car breaks)
- Meds/records (if required by airline or destination)
